Real-World Application: The Tote Bag Test

To truly understand the viability of this design, I imagined applying it to a common project: a heavy canvas tote bag. This is a staple item for Etsy sellers and craft fair vendors. The I m Not a Control Freak Sassy Quote would sit prominently on the front panel. In this scenario, the design’s scale is critical. If the text is too small, the intricate parts of the letters might get lost in the weave of the canvas. If it is too large, it could cause puckering if the stabilizer is not up to par.

For a tote bag, I would recommend using a dense fill stitch or a bold satin stitch border around the letters to ensure durability. Tote bags are functional items that get tossed into cars, dragged across floors, and washed frequently. The embroidery needs to withstand this wear and tear. Adapting for Apparel and Home Decor

Beyond tote bags, this design has significant potential in custom apparel. Imagine this quote stitched onto the chest of a cozy sweatshirt or the back of a structured cap. For sweatshirt embroidery, the fabric is thicker and more forgiving, allowing for slightly higher stitch density without causing distortion. However, on a cap, the curved surface presents a challenge. The text must be arched or carefully centered to avoid looking warped when worn. I would advise testing the design on a scrap piece of similar material to check how the curves of the letters interact with the hoop tension.

In the realm of home decor, this quote could work beautifully on a kitchen towel or an apron. These are popular personalized gift items, especially for holidays or housewarmings. The humor fits the chaotic energy of a busy kitchen. However, kitchen textiles undergo frequent washing and high heat. Ensuring that the thread colors are colorfast and that the stitch density is optimized to prevent snagging is essential. A running stitch outline might be too delicate for an apron that sees heavy use, so a combination of satin and fill stitches would provide the necessary robustness.

Technical Considerations for Embroiderers

Before loading the digital embroidery file into your machine, there are several technical factors to consider. The product description notes that the download includes SVG, PNG, and DXF files. While these are excellent for printing or cutting, embroidery machines typically require specific formats like PES, DST, or JEF. If you are using this as a reference for manual digitizing, the vector files are invaluable. If you are expecting a pre-digitized embroidery file, you must verify the format compatibility with your specific machine before purchase.

Stitch density is another major concern. Sassy quotes often utilize script fonts, which can be tricky. Thin lines in script fonts may require a satin stitch, but if the column width is too narrow, the thread might not cover the fabric properly, leading to gaps. Conversely, if the density is too high, the fabric will pucker. I strongly recommend stitching out a test sample on scrap fabric using the same stabilizer and thread you plan to use for the final product. This step saves time, money, and frustration.

Fabric texture also plays a role. On smooth cotton or polyester blends, the design will appear crisp and clean. On textured fabrics like linen or terry cloth, some details might get lost. For dark fabrics, ensure you are using high-contrast thread colors to maintain legibility. A white or bright yellow thread on a navy blue sweatshirt will pop, whereas a pastel shade might blend in too much, diminishing the impact of the quote.

Commercial Viability and Brand Consistency

For small shop products and craft business owners, consistency is key. The I m Not a Control Freak Sassy Quote fits well within a brand identity that is bold, humorous, and relatable. It appeals to customers who value authenticity and wit. When listing this as a finished product on platforms like Etsy, high-quality mockups are essential. Since the download includes PNG files, you can create realistic printable mockup previews to show customers how the design looks on various items.

However, always double-check the licensing terms. Just because a file is available for instant download does not automatically grant commercial rights for resale. Confirm whether the license allows you to sell physical items made with the design or if it is for personal use only. Protecting your business from copyright issues is just as important as the quality of your stitching.
